  7. Oct 4, 2016
    7
    007: Quantum Of Solace is a surprisingly good movie tie-in.

    The gameplay does feel very similar to COD 4,though it's by Treyarch,so what were you expecting?.It has a cover system,which switches you to third person from first,and you are extremely accurate from cover,which makes the game a bit too easy.The stealth sections are awful,about the gameplay's only flaw.     The graphics are decent,but nothing special.The framerate is solid,and never even hitches.The enviroments are well-varied too.

    Sound design and soundtrack are mediocre.

    Overall,Quantum Of Solace is a solid movie tie-in FPS that is worth at least trying even if you,like me,are not a fan of Bond.

    A hybrid first-person/third-person shooter that covers events from "Quantum" and Casino Royale. The game is fun, but it doesn't feel very Bond-like. It's more comparable to Gears of War or Rainbow Six Vegas. Some stealth sections help break up the non-stop action. Controls are fluid and the graphics are impressive. Overall, this is an enjoyable action game. I would rate it with a 7.3 out of 10.

    Decent shooter even if it is another call of duty clone. I liked the gears of war style cover mechanic and character models. Level design is pretty bland in the quantum levels while it's much better in the Casino Royale levels.
